What you'll typically need

  • Your recipient's full name, as it appears on their ID
  • Their phone number and preferred way to receive the money (for example, Lumicash, Lumitel, or bank transfer)
  • The amount you want to send, in euros

What the process looks like

  1. Message us on WhatsApp, or start your transfer on the send money page, with your amount and how your recipient wants to receive it.
  2. We confirm the fee upfront — for transfers up to €100 it's a flat €6, and 6% above that. You can see exact examples on our fees page.
  3. You make your payment.
  4. We process the transfer and let you know once your recipient has received it.

A note on exchange rates

Because Burundi uses the Burundian Franc (BIF) and France uses the Euro, every transfer involves a currency exchange. The rate applied can vary day to day, so we confirm it with you directly before you send, rather than publishing a rate that might be outdated by the time you pay.
